Oberseminar Differentialgeometrie: Reto Buzano (Turin): Bubbling analysis for closed and free-boundary minimal hypersurfaces.

Monday, 28.10.2019 16:15 im Raum SR4

Mathematik und Informatik

Abstract: We will discuss a variety of weak and strong compactness results for sequences of minimal hypersurfaces (with and without boundary) in compact Riemannian manifolds of dimension between 3 and 7. In particular, exploiting a precise bubbling analysis, we obtain new strong compactness theorems in dimension 3 that extend results of Choi-Schoen and Fraser-Li from ambient manifolds with positive Ricci curvature to manifolds with only positive scalar curvature under the additional assumption of an index bound. The presented results have been obtained in joint work with Lucas Ambrozio, Alessandro Carlotto, and Ben Sharp.
